What West Virginia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in software consultant jobs across West Virginia.

  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, or a closely related field
  • Demonstrated experience with enterprise software platforms such as SAP, Oracle, or Salesforce
  • Proficiency in at least one major cloud environment, including A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ud
  • Strong client-facing communication skills and experience delivering technology recommendations
  • Familiarity with government or healthcare IT environments common across West Virginia employers
  • Project management or agile methodology experience, with certifications such as PMP or CSM preferred

How do you become a software consultant in West Virginia?

Most software consultant roles in West Virginia require a bach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, or a related technical field. There is no state-issued license specific to software consulting in West Virginia, so employers focus on industry certifications such as AWS, Microsoft Azure, or PMP alongside demonstrated project experience. Candidates targeting government contractors or healthcare clients often strengthen their profile with a security clearance or familiarity with HIPAA compliance requirements.

Are there remote software consultant jobs in West Virginia?

Yes, and more than most fields. About 27% of software consultant openings tied to West Virginia are remote or hybrid as of July 2026, reflecting the desk-based and advisory nature of the work. Roles focused on cloud architecture, software implementation, and IT strategy are the most consistently offered as fully remote or hybrid arrangements.

How can I get hired as a software consultant in West Virginia with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is through an associate consultant or junior analyst role at a federal contractor or healthcare IT firm in Charleston or Morgantown. West Virginia University's computer science and information systems programs have established relationships with regional employers who recruit new graduates for entry-level consulting positions. Building a portfolio of hands-on projects, earning a cloud or agile certification, and targeting roles titled IT analyst, implementation specialist, or systems analyst can open the door without prior consulting experience.
